Handover: charset sniffing in Textgrove

Hey Marek — before you review the branch, some context. Textgrove's encoding detection for uploaded text files now runs a two-pass sniff: byte-order marks first, then a statistical pass using the Ferndale tables. The old heuristic mislabeled Turkish and Czech files constantly, hence the rewrite. Mixed-encoding files fall back to a configurable default rather than erroring. The detector reads its thresholds from the settings pasted below.

config for kaguf-tahop:
fenir:
  pin: 0174
  tenant: novix
  seal: seal_58ebeb9f
  metrics_host: metrics.fenir.halixsoft.corp
  standby_team: gilys
  escalation: weniel-feniel
  nonce: 50fe55

### SQL lint rules

For this week's sync: the Copperline linter now enforces structural rules on all SQL files in the Marrowfield repo — statement length ceilings, mandatory keyset pagination on unbounded selects, and a ban on implicit cross joins. Violations are warnings for two sprints, then hard failures. We deliberately kept thresholds conservative so legacy migrations pass; we'll tighten after the audit. The enforcement thresholds the linter reads at startup are defined below.

tuning constants:
QUOTAS = {
    "druwyn": 5,
    "holix": 5,
    "zorath": 5,
    "holwyn": 10,
}

## Runbook: Payroll Export Format Change (Tallygrove v7)

As of the v7 cutover, payroll exports use the pipe-delimited Tallygrove format instead of fixed-width. The nightly export job validates column counts before upload; a mismatch halts the run and pages on-call. If paged: check the `export_runs` table for the failing batch, confirm the template version is 7, and re-queue. Do not hand-edit export files. The export metadata lives in the payroll staging database, connected via the string below.

primary connection of yagep-kahip = redis://giliel_svc:zYiKsLL2PLpfPL@db-348f.xolmarsys.corp:5432/fenwyn

Action item: The Relayn deploy-status bot silently dropped updates when the pipeline API paginated results, so responders believed a rollback had completed when it had not. We will add pagination handling, a staleness banner, and an integration test. Until merged, verify deploy state directly in the pipeline console, documented at the page below.

runbook for kahop-kajop: https://rundeck.ordinio.test/display/secrets/pipeline/issue/pages/repo/browse/e5732776e07d1285107e5aeb